Terra Alta (Western Catalan: [ˈtɛra ˈalta]) is a sparsely populated inland comarca (county)inTerres de l'Ebre, Catalonia (Spain). Its capital is Gandesa. It is also known as Castellania, a name dating back to its medieval status as a fiefdom held by the Order of Knights of the Hospital of St. John of Jerusalem under the Crown of Aragon.

Municipalities

[edit]
Municipality Population
(2014)[1]
Area
km2[1]
Arnes 474 43.0
Batea 1,975 128.4
Bot 630 34.9
Caseres 267 42.9
Corbera d'Ebre 1,136 53.1
La Fatarella 1,051 56.5
Gandesa 3,091 71.2
Horta de Sant Joan 1,219 119.0
El Pinell de Brai 1,076 57.0
La Pobla de Massaluca 354 43.4
Prat de Comte 164 26.4
Vilalba dels Arcs 682 67.2
• Total: 12 12,119 743.0
